Background on Aaron Chia and Soh Wooi Yik

Aaron Chia and Soh Wooi Yik, Malaysia’s premier men’s doubles pair, have been steadily making waves on the international badminton circuit. Since their formation as a pair, their synergy, aggressive style of play, and mental toughness have seen them climb the world rankings and earn respect from competitors worldwide.

  • Early Career and Partnership Formation:
    Aaron and Soh first paired up several years ago under the guidance of the Badminton Association of Malaysia. Their complementary playing styles—Aaron’s power and precision combined with Soh’s speed and court awareness—quickly made them a formidable duo.
  • Achievements So Far:
    The pair has won numerous titles, including several BWF World Tour events, and have consistently been among Malaysia’s top contenders for major international championships. Their crowning achievement came when they clinched the bronze medal at the Tokyo 2020 Olympics, marking Malaysia’s return to the Olympic badminton podium after many years.
  • Playing Style:
    Aaron and Soh’s style is characterized by aggressive net play, tactical smashes, and coordinated rotations. They exhibit great communication on court, which helps them cover spaces effectively and pressure opponents.

The Rivalry with Man Wei Chong and Tee Kai Wun

The upcoming Masters rematch against Man Wei Chong and Tee Kai Wun is one of the most talked-about matches in Malaysian badminton circles. This rivalry has been growing steadily, fueled by exciting matches and closely contested results.

  • About Man and Tee
    Man Wei Chong and Tee Kai Wun are another prominent Malaysian men’s doubles pair known for their speed, relentless defense, and sharp reflexes at the net. They have been steadily improving and recently upset several higher-ranked opponents in international competitions.
  • Past Encounters
    Aaron and Soh have faced Man and Tee multiple times, with victories and defeats traded on both sides. The intensity of their matches often brings out the best in both pairs, providing fans with exhilarating badminton.
  • Significance of Their Rivalry
    This rivalry is unique because it features two pairs from the same country competing at the highest level. It showcases the depth of Malaysian badminton talent and sparks friendly competition that pushes both teams to elevate their games.
